Output 3f1c4c28ba07bc3150adba1c4cea82f415a36fd59cfe248cd817ca262219d42a:40

value
3116103
script pubkey
OP_0 OP_PUSHBYTES_20 abdda025ec193fc6d0fbcdabf9c83550a1fd230a
address
bc1q40w6qf0vrylud58mek4lnjp42zsl6gc2nuvl8q
transaction
3f1c4c28ba07bc3150adba1c4cea82f415a36fd59cfe248cd817ca262219d42a
spent
true